Поделиться через


структура NVME_CDW11_FIRMWARE_DOWNLOAD (nvme.h)

Содержит параметры для команды Загрузки образа встроенного ПО, которая используется для копирования нового образа встроенного ПО (полностью или частично) на контроллер.

Команда Загрузки образа встроенного ПО использует поля PRP Entry 1 PRP1 и PRP Entry 2 PRP2 , а также поля Command Dword 10 CDW10 и Command Dword 11 CDW11 в параметре FIRMWAREDOWNLOAD структуры Command . Все остальные поля, относящиеся к командам в параметре FIRMWAREDOWNLOAD , зарезервированы.

Структура NVME_CDW11_FIRMWARE_DOWNLOAD используется в качестве значения параметра CDW11 в поле FIRMWAREDOWNLOAD структуры команд .

Синтаксис

typedef struct {
  ULONG OFST;
} NVME_CDW11_FIRMWARE_DOWNLOAD, *PNVME_CDW11_FIRMWARE_DOWNLOAD;

Члены

OFST

Поле Смещение (OFST) указывает количество смещений Dwords с начала изображения встроенного ПО, скачиваемого на контроллер. Смещение используется для создания полного образа встроенного ПО при загрузке встроенного ПО несколькими частями. Элемент, соответствующий началу образа встроенного ПО, имеет смещение 0h.

Требования

Требование Значение
Минимальная версия клиента Windows 10
Верхняя часть nvme.h

См. также раздел